"We must learn to walk before we can run" nghĩa là gì?


"We must learn to walk before we can run" = hãy học đi bộ trước đã rồi hẵng chạy nhảy -> nghĩa là phải thuần thục các kĩ năng cơ bản trước khi tiến tới những cái phức tạp hơn.
